Company

A long‑standing British manufacturer with international operations and a key focus on sustainability.

Main Duties

  • Provide outstanding customer service to clients and support the Export department.
  • Respond to customer enquiries promptly to ensure any issues are resolved.
  • Provide customers with advice on product suitability and alternatives to competitor products to encourage greater spend.
  • Process orders via the system and follow up as necessary.
  • Provide customers with export support regarding lead times and delivery information.
  • Support internal departments with product or stock information.
  • Ensure customer information is recorded accurately and update on the system when necessary.
  • Monitor outstanding orders and follow up accordingly.

Candidate

  • Fluent in German or French to business standard – essential.
  • Previous customer service experience – essential.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Dynamic, confident and motivated.
  • IT literate.

Salary and Benefits

£27,000 per annum plus bonus.

Location

Burnley – office based role.
